你知道有哪些公式组合可以提取唯一值?

点击上方

蓝色

文字  关注我们吧!

送人玫瑰,手有余香,请将文章分享给更多朋友

动手操作是熟练掌握EXCEL的最快捷途径!

下面是一份某商场某些产品的进货明细。由于各个品牌的商品中还有不同型号的进货记录,因此下表中的数据肯定有重复的。下面的几个技巧将在重复品牌中提取唯一的品牌。

01

通过LOOKUP函数配合MATCH函数我们可以实现提取唯一清单的目的。

在单元格E2中输入公式“=IFERROR(LOOKUP(0,0/ISNA(MATCH($B$2:$B$14,$E$1:E1,)),$B$2:$B$14),"")”,向下拖曳即可。

思路:

  • 利用MATCH函数来查找所有品牌在E列的混合引用中是否已经存在

  • 若不存在则MATCH函数返回#N/A错误,ISNA返回TRUE,0/TRUE 返回0

  • 利用LOOKUP函数来提取唯一的清单

02

我们也可以利用MATCH函数组合COUNTIF函数来完成。

在单元格E2中输入“=IFERROR(INDEX($B$2:$B$14,MATCH(0,COUNTIF($E$1:E1,$B$2:$B$14),0)),"")”,三键回车并向下拖曳即可。

思路:

  • 利用COUNTIF函数统计所有品牌在E列的混合引用中是否存在,若不存在则返回0

  • 利用MATCH函数0值定位的技巧定位未提取的品牌名称

  • 利用INDEX函数返回唯一清单

03

利用FREQUENCY函数也可以达到目的。

在单元格E2中输入公式“=LOOKUP(0,0/FREQUENCY(1,--ISNA(MATCH($B$2:$B$14,$E$1:E1,))),$B$2:$B$14)&""”,三键回车并向下拖曳即可。

思路:

  • --ISNA(MATCH($B$2:$B$14,$E$1:E1,))部分和第一例类似,但由于要配合FREQUENCY函数,因此将逻辑值转换为数值

  • 利用FREQUENCY函数计频

  • 利用LOOKUP函数来提取唯一的清单

04

最常用的方法还是提取不重复值的经典公式。

这个由于我们之前做过多次介绍,这里就不再详细的解释了。有疑问的小伙伴们可以私信我哦!

-END-

长按下方二维码关注EXCEL应用之家

面对EXCEL操作问题时不再迷茫无助

推荐阅读:

IF函数七兄弟,个个本领大!

一对多查询经典函数组合拓展应用--多对多查询

来,平均一下!

总结篇--反向查找函数使用终极帖

遇到不规范的数据录入,你该怎么办?

戳原文,更有料!免费模板文档!

(0)

相关推荐